Output 2c1c79eb4fb8ff7900ee6e9d8b8c288fedc19816c3997e6ee5b093d012f13310:3

value
684360000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 501d522786a0995ff4e1d7ac06b823259a4c54ff OP_EQUAL
address
38zd79Fi4w2tzRRn1vMwMQTBKmfLjcWBxS
transaction
2c1c79eb4fb8ff7900ee6e9d8b8c288fedc19816c3997e6ee5b093d012f13310
spent
true